Brazil and U.S. select 540 English teachers
September 10 marked the official announcement of the expanded program to send 540 public school English teachers to the U.S. in 2013. Brazil aims to provide opportunities for educators to learn about international best practices in education, share experiences and improve the quality of public education.

Report Reveals Visa Improvements for Visitors to U.S.
The White House report, released on September 19, reveals that the U.S. Mission in Brazil reached a milestone in visa processing, joining Mexico and China as the only U.S. missions that process more than 1 million visas each year.

U.S.Mission to Brazil announces visa statistics for August 2012
The United States Diplomatic Mission to Brazil processed 86,734 visa applications in August 2012. The wait time for an appointment for a visa interview has fallen throughout the Mission.
